Look, I fixed it! 200 1990

So, I've been working on my latest addition to my fleet and here is what I just fixed, or shall I say the PO fixed.



PO's fix for a stripped out oil bolt

I do remember seeing this when inspecting the car, but it did not dawn on me what was going on until last weekend when I went to drain the oil before doing some major engine freshening.

Here is what the pan and fix looked like once out of the car.


Pan out showing oil plug fix

The next two photo's just show how badly stripped the bolt hole was. I still have it and plan to fix it for future use. Will need a bigger bolt.


stripped 1


stripped 2

These are images of the new to me pan that I pulled on Tuesday from my local PNP off of a 91' sedan. The pan is a little dented, but hey it does not leak and the drain plug is not stripped. Score for me!


New to me pan outside


inside of new to me pan


Hope you all enjoyed the show. A lot more fun posting it than fixing/living it.
